EnaiSiaion Posted February 22, 2013 Share Posted February 22, 2013 Abilities are passive bonuses and do not "cast". Try making a separate paralysis spell and giving your ability a script that does something like this: Spell Property YourParalysisSpell AutoFloat Property UpdateRate = 0.2 AutoEvent OnEffectStart(Actor akTarget, Actor akCaster) RegisterForSingleUpdate(UpdateRate)EndEventEvent OnUpdate() YourParalysisSpell.Cast(GetTargetActor()) RegisterForSingleUpdate(UpdateRate)EndEvent Note: this will cause the IsDualCasting flag to get reset to zero each time the paralysis subspell is cast, breaking things like Impact. Perhaps using RemoteCast on self instead of Cast will fix this.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
EnaiSiaion Posted February 22, 2013 Share Posted February 22, 2013 As for the stone texture, there's a nice unused Stoneflesh effectshader which you can use directly (field Hit Shader). Blindfold: see how the Stoneflesh spell works, in particular its armor related conditions.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Medusa30 Posted February 24, 2013 Author Share Posted February 24, 2013 (edited) I found a good solution by myself. I gave the player actor the following script: Scriptname AsenRaceScript extends ObjectReference {Asen race specific properties and functions.} Spell Property YourParalysisSpell Auto Float Property UpdateRate = 0.2 Auto Actor CasterRef Actor TargetRef EVENT onInit() YourParalysisSpell.cast(Game.GetPlayer(),TargetRef) RegisterForSingleUpdate(UpdateRate) ENDEVENT Event OnUpdate() YourParalysisSpell.cast(Game.GetPlayer(),TargetRef) RegisterForSingleUpdate(UpdateRate) EndEvent Works quite well and brought me a huge laugh when I tested the VoiceIceStorm3 spell with this. I could implement a race specific condition, but since I wanted to start with a new intro an only the Asen race, I made only them playable so its not needed for me anyway. But those who want to make a permanent running spell might find it useful. :biggrin: PS: Im not a good scripter so this code might be a bit messi.
